How Refinishing Addresses Cabinet Surface Damage
Sanding removes the existing finish layer along with surface stains, heat damage near appliances, and discoloration from grease exposure or cleaning products. This mechanical preparation exposes fresh wood and creates the anchor pattern that allows new finishes to adhere properly. The quality of sanding work directly determines how smooth the final finish appears and how long it resists chipping or peeling.

Refinishing works best when cabinet construction is solid wood or high-quality plywood, as laminate and thermofoil surfaces require different treatment approaches. The process typically takes less time than full replacement and produces substantially less construction debris.

What is the difference between refinishing and painting cabinets?
Refinishing involves sanding away the existing finish to bare wood before applying new stain or paint, while painting typically applies new paint over lightly sanded existing finishes, with refinishing providing better adhesion and longer-lasting results.
How durable are refinished cabinet surfaces?
When properly prepared and finished with high-quality topcoats, refinished cabinets resist scratches, moisture, and cleaning chemicals comparably to factory finishes, typically lasting ten to fifteen years before requiring touch-ups.
What cabinet conditions make refinishing impractical?
Cabinets with particleboard construction, delaminating veneer, broken joints, or significant structural damage cost more to repair than replace, making refinishing less cost-effective than new cabinetry in those situations.
How long does cabinet refinishing take?
Most kitchen cabinet refinishing projects require seven to ten days, including preparation, drying time between coats, and reassembly, with bathroom cabinets typically completing within three to five days.
Can cabinet hardware be updated during refinishing?
Hardware replacement integrates easily into refinishing projects, with new handles or hinges installed during reassembly, and old mounting holes filled and sanded during preparation if you're changing hardware styles.
